Comparison review

The Moto G60s has a general score of 79.9, which is a bit better than Sony Xperia Z3+'s overall score of 73.7. The Moto G60s body is noticeably thicker and a lot heavier than Sony Xperia Z3+. These devices come with Android operating system, but Moto G60s has 11 version and Sony Xperia Z3+ has Android 5.0, so it gives you some additional features and performance optimizations.

The Xperia Z3+ features a better display than Motorola Moto G60s, because although it has a really smaller display and a little bit worse resolution of 1920 x 1080px, it also counts with a little bit greater display pixels density. The Moto G60s counts with a bit more powerful processing unit than Xperia Z3+, because it has 7 more CPU cores and a greater amount of RAM memory.

Motorola Moto G60s features a way bigger storage to store more apps and games than Xperia Z3+, because it has 128 GB internal memory capacity and a SD extension slot that allows a maximum of 1 TB. Moto G60s counts with a very superior battery life than Xperia Z3+, because it has a 5000mAh battery size against 2930mAh.

The Motorola Moto G60s captures slightly better videos and photos than Xperia Z3+, and although they both have the same 3840x2160 (4K) video quality and the same 30 frames per second video frame rates, the Motorola Moto G60s also has a back facing camera with way more mega-pixels and a bigger aperture.
